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Pangbourne to St Annes-on-the-Sea start from as little as £40.30

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Pangbourne to St Annes-on-the-Sea start from £86.90 one way, or £124.20 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Pangbourne to St Annes-on-the-Sea are available for £87.90 one way, or £175.80 return

Facilities at Pangbourne Train Station

Pangbourne Station offers a range of facilities to ensure a smooth travel experience. For those purchasing tickets, there is a ticket office available from 06:20 to 12:50 on weekdays and from 07:00 to 13:30 on Saturdays. Ticket machines are also accessible, making the collection of online-purchased tickets a breeze. The station prides itself on its accessible amenities, including clearly marked step-free paths to certain platforms. However, it is essential to note that not all areas are fully accessible, so it's advisable to plan ahead if mobility is a concern.

For those needing assistance, customer help points are strategically placed around the station. CCTV cameras ensure security, and the public Wi-Fi network keeps you connected while you wait. Unfortunately, the station lacks certain conveniences such as refreshment facilities and ATMs, so plan to arrive prepared.

Onward Travel Options

Starting your journey at Pangbourne Station means having a range of onward travel options. The station provides easy access to local bus services, with clearly marked stops along the A329 Shooters Hill. For longer journeys, connections at Reading Station can link you to larger airports like Heathrow and Gatwick. While there is no specific taxi rank at the station, alternative services are available to suit diverse travel needs. Station Facilities You’ll Appreciate

St Annes-on-the-Sea prides itself in offering an accessible station environment for everyone. With step-free access throughout the station, it caters to those with mobility challenges and families with prams. This category A station is equipped with accessible ticket machines and an induction loop to assist those with hearing difficulties. While there's no waiting room, ample seating is provided. Although lacking in refreshment and shopping facilities, it offers standard amenities including a ticket office open Monday through Saturday and around-the-clock parking facilities managed by Northern Rail.

Planning Your Onward Journey

Transitioning from rail journeys to other transport modes is seamless at St Annes-on-the-Sea. Bus services are within easy reach, while taxis can be organised through dedicated phone lines or booking service Cab4You. Do check for rail replacement services which are picked up outside on St Andrews Road North. Although bicycle hire isn't directly available at the station, bicycle storage options, such as stands, are available for those bringing their own bikes.
